U.S. patent number D681,613 [Application Number D/429,925] was granted by the patent office on 2013-05-07 for case for electronic device. This patent grant is currently assigned to Otter Products, LLC. The grantee listed for this patent is Cameron Magness, Nathan Northrup. Invention is credited to Cameron Magness, Nathan Northrup.

Description



FIG. 1 is a front isometric view of a case for electronic device showing our new design;

FIG. 2 is a rear isometric view thereof;

FIG. 3 is a front view thereof;

FIG. 4 is a rear view thereof;

FIG. 5 is a left view thereof;

FIG. 6 is a right view thereof;

FIG. 7 is a top view thereof; and,

FIG. 8 is a bottom view thereof.

The broken lines immediately adjacent the shaded surfaces represent boundaries of the claimed design. All other broken lines depict unclaimed environment. The broken lines and unshaded regions bounded by the broken lines form no part of the claimed design.
